USS Minneapolis St. Paul, Four Sailor Deaths, 12/29/2006

Four crew members were washed overboard by heavy waves on 29 December 2006 in Plymouth Sound, England as the ship was exiting HMNB Devonport on the surface following a port call. This resulted in the deaths of Senior Chief Petty Officer Thomas Higgins (Chief of the Boat) and Sonar Technician (Submarines) 2nd Class Michael Holtz. After the preliminary investigation, Commander Edwin Ruff, the Commanding Officer, received a punitive letter of reprimand and was relieved of command. (Source: Wikipedia)
